- Check for Certification
When looking for a used car dealership in Tulsa, it's important to look for certification. The National Independent Automobile Dealers Association (NIADA) offers a Certified Pre-Owned Program, which guarantees that a vehicle has been inspected, repaired, and has a clean title. Look for dealerships that offer this certification or a similar program.
- Research the Dealership's Reputation
Before making a purchase, it's important to research the dealership's reputation. Look for online reviews and ask for referrals from friends and family. You can also check with the Better Business Bureau to see if any complaints have been filed against the dealership.

- Check the Car's History
It's important to check the car's history before making a purchase. This can help you avoid buying a car with a salvage title or one that has been in an accident. You can use services like Carfax or AutoCheck to get a vehicle history report.

- Check for a Warranty
Look for dealerships that offer a warranty on their used cars. A warranty can give you peace of mind and protect you from unexpected repair costs. Be sure to read the warranty details carefully and ask any questions you have before making a purchase.

- Test Drive the Car
Before making a purchase, be sure to test drive the car. This can help you get a feel for how the car handles and whether it's the right fit for you. Additionally, be sure to test drive the car in different conditions, such as on the highway or in stop-and-go traffic.
- Negotiate the Price
Don't be afraid to negotiate the price of the car. Look for dealerships that offer fair prices and be prepared to walk away if the price isn't right. Additionally, be sure to negotiate the price of any additional services, such as financing or a warranty.
- Read the Contract Carefully
Before signing on the dotted line, be sure to read the contract carefully. Make sure you understand the terms of the sale, including the price, financing terms, and any additional services or warranties.
